Output 261c84df29a5dd423eebcd53f840f3de568ce05a1c01fbe227662d161834cdcd:3

value
65421
script pubkey
OP_0 OP_PUSHBYTES_20 bb00ebf88e9e6d71a3a417be3edcb463c141ab64
address
bc1qhvqwh7ywnekhrgayz7lrah95v0q5r2myxhndqr
transaction
261c84df29a5dd423eebcd53f840f3de568ce05a1c01fbe227662d161834cdcd
spent
true